	After some changes to streams and topologies, receiving fax through local channels stopped working. This change adds a stream topology with a stream of type IMAGE to the local channel pair and allows fax to be received. | /*!
 | |
|  * \brief The base pvt structure for local channel derivatives.
 | |
|  *
 | |
|  * The unreal pvt has two ast_chan objects - the "owner" and the "next channel", the outbound channel
 | |
|  *
 | |
|  * ast_chan owner -> ast_unreal_pvt -> ast_chan chan
 | |
|  */
 | |
| struct ast_unreal_pvt {
 | |
| 	struct ast_unreal_pvt_callbacks *callbacks; /*!< Event callbacks */
 | |
| 	struct ast_channel *owner;                  /*!< Master Channel - ;1 side */
 | |
| 	struct ast_channel *chan;                   /*!< Outbound channel - ;2 side */
 | |
| 	struct ast_format_cap *reqcap;              /*!< Requested format capabilities */
 | |
| 	struct ast_jb_conf jb_conf;                 /*!< jitterbuffer configuration */
 | |
| 	unsigned int flags;                         /*!< Private option flags */
 | |
| 	/*! Base name of the unreal channels.  exten@context or other name. */
 | |
| 	char name[AST_MAX_EXTENSION + AST_MAX_CONTEXT + 2];
 | |
| 	struct ast_stream_topology *reqtopology;    /*!< Requested stream topology */
 | |
| 	struct ast_stream_topology *owner_old_topology;	/*!< Stored topology for owner side when we need to restore later (faxing) */
 | |
| 	struct ast_stream_topology *chan_old_topology;	/*!< Stored topology for chan side when we need to restore later (faxing) */
 | |
| };
 | |
| 
 | |
| #define AST_UNREAL_IS_OUTBOUND(a, b) ((a) == (b)->chan ? 1 : 0)
 | |
| 
 | |
| #define AST_UNREAL_CARETAKER_THREAD (1 << 0) /*!< The ;2 side launched a PBX, was pushed into a bridge, or was masqueraded into an application. */
 | |
| #define AST_UNREAL_NO_OPTIMIZATION  (1 << 1) /*!< Do not optimize out the unreal channels */
 | |
| #define AST_UNREAL_MOH_INTERCEPT    (1 << 2) /*!< Intercept and act on hold/unhold control frames */
 | |
| #define AST_UNREAL_OPTIMIZE_BEGUN   (1 << 3) /*!< Indicates that an optimization attempt has been started */
